Other Parties
Other political parties have also promoted social credit principles, including John C. Turmel's Christian Credit Party and Abolitionist Party of Canada, and the short-lived Canada Party. The Global Party of Canada also appears to promote social credit economic policies.
The Canadian Action Party has monetary reform policies in its platform, but is not considered to be a social credit party.
